Police charge man after Black Range stabbing

Northern Grampians Crime Investigation Unit detectives have charged a 37-year-old man following an alleged stabbing at Black Range, south of Stawell, yesterday afternoon.

The Black Range man was charged this morning with intentionally cause serious injury and other assault-related offences.

He was remanded in custody to appear in Horsham Magistrates' Court tomorrow.

The charges relate to an incident where a 37-year-old man sustained stab wounds at a caravan park on Monaghan Road about 3.55pm.

He was airlifted to hospital where he remains in a serious but stable condition.
